Patty pan squash growing season. Patty pan squash does best in full sun, and the soil should be kept moist. The seeds should germinate in about 7 to 14 days. Patty pan skin is thin and tender.

Patty pan squash grows quickly (in about 55 days) and can be harvested throughout the warmer months, typically until the first hard freeze of the season. Patty pan squash, also known as scallop squash, is part of the summer squash family known as cucurbita pepo. Red kuri squash is a japanese squash.

Patty pan squash are not a frost tolerant vegetable. Here at the farm we plant seeds directly in the field. These take 57 days to harvest.

Sowing patty pan seed generally, you can sow seed in spring and summer, and either in trays or directly into the soil.
